Transaction d524a61ef3113617d31e672ec96a1a732a52e4fb9757e0249b9c7bef163fee4e

2 Input
2 Outputs
  • d524a61ef3113617d31e672ec96a1a732a52e4fb9757e0249b9c7bef163fee4e:0
  • value  1007122
    address  14YkYUGwEmu8eZF586maQNYXHRv1A6Yk7p
  • d524a61ef3113617d31e672ec96a1a732a52e4fb9757e0249b9c7bef163fee4e:1
  • value  58572878
    address  1DuuiXYwqu53PLAg7PBXW3U8CitVkefBCK